9. Maybe not so insane
The reports say that it was the banks that originally contacted the FBI, because of some big and out of the ordinary funds transfers to dummy companies that Spitzer was using to try and put some distance between himself and the hooker ring.

The first instinct of any FBI investigator with a high profile public official moving money through non-existent companies is bribery or other political shenanigans. That's how the FBI got the wiretap warrants they used to pin him down, based on a judge's review of the funds activity. So money laundering isn't that far off as a possible accusation.

That's my guess as to why he hasn't resigned yet. Resignation is a big bargaining chip with the Feds. e.g. "I'll resign and you make these charges go away."

The irony of the deal is Spitzer was a huge fan of wiretaps for investigations when he was AG for NYS.
